Output 3f26649e5eed66fa0fcfd340bc686238d873a89658ed7cac3530f190d9d95bc6:1

value
21326266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94afc8901cd25e196fde0ba20194097ae8d9fb53 OP_EQUAL
address
3FFCWakq4cj9SuoDQm3tYW7q1RkSpxzjyK
transaction
3f26649e5eed66fa0fcfd340bc686238d873a89658ed7cac3530f190d9d95bc6
spent
true